Transaction e5673edce036e9dd99cc39bc4b778ca4f32f75629644068292034edd347afcdc
1 Input
2 Outputs
- e5673edce036e9dd99cc39bc4b778ca4f32f75629644068292034edd347afcdc:0
- e5673edce036e9dd99cc39bc4b778ca4f32f75629644068292034edd347afcdc:1
value 2957705
address 3PpaVCypnupcY7NLqgEMBhLhYYtYXHzf5o
value 4815595
address 1KeMj1fnhsJDimBdwbogTyrXGbr8nk4LUB